五、JavaScript:前端开发的通用语言 尽管受到AI生成代码的冲击,JavaScript仍然是网页交互功能实现的基础语言,配合HTML/CSS构成现代Web开发的三大支柱。
立即学习“C++免费学习笔记(深入)”; 支持多种操作:重载和拷贝控制 一个实用的泛型结构需要处理对象的构造、赋值和析构。
辅助函数方法在引入一个新函数的同时,使调用处的代码更简洁,并提高了代码的复用性。
关键是选对算法、保护好密钥、合理集成到数据访问流程中。
它不仅仅是数据的存储格式,更是一种关于数据“语义”的约定。
这不仅可以解决版本冲突问题,还能保持您的系统Python环境的清洁。
106 查看详情 示例: <font color="blue">cmd := exec.Command("ls", "-l") cmd.Stdout = os.Stdout cmd.Stderr = os.Stderr err := cmd.Run() if err != nil { log.Fatal(err) }</font> 也可以在执行前为子进程设置特定环境变量: <font color="blue">cmd.Env = append(os.Environ(), "CUSTOM_VAR=custom_value")</font> 这样子进程会继承当前环境,并额外添加自定义变量。
3. 解决方案:采用TINYINT(1)替代BIT(1) 解决此问题的最直接且可靠的方法是,将数据库中所有用于存储布尔值或0/1状态的BIT(1)类型字段,更改为TINYINT(1)类型。
使用set_error_handler()捕获E_WARNING、E_NOTICE等非致命错误 使用register_shutdown_function()配合error_get_last()捕获致命错误 通过set_exception_handler()设置未被捕获异常的最终处理逻辑 这样即使出现Parse Error或Call to undefined function等错误,也能进入统一的错误响应流程,避免空白页面暴露敏感信息。
推荐方案:缓冲区持有期间的尺寸锁定策略 Python自身的内置类型,如 bytearray 和 array.array,在处理动态内存和缓冲区协议的冲突时,采取了一种标准且高效的策略:当存在活动的缓冲区视图时,阻止对底层数组进行任何可能导致内存重新分配或尺寸改变的操作。
28 查看详情 核心思路: 创建一个带缓冲(容量为1)的done通道。
处理中文推荐使用 mb_substr() 函数。
简洁性:API设计直观,易于理解和使用。
先移除后修改再添加: 当需要更新影响元素排序键的底层数据时,标准的处理流程是: 将元素从SortedSet中移除 (discard或remove)。
结合groupby().transform(),这种方法能够高效地处理大规模数据集,避免了Python循环的开销,尤其适用于拥有大量分组和记录的场景。
实时性需求:物流追踪可能需要近乎实时的更新。
类型转换:将分割得到的每个数值字符串转换为浮点数。
RAII不是某种语法结构,而是一种编程范式。
此时,strings.TrimSuffix尝试移除一个空字符串,结果是返回原始字符串,这正是我们期望的行为。
根据奈奎斯特-香农采样定理,为了无损地重构原始模拟信号,采样率必须至少是信号中最高频率成分的两倍。
本文链接:http://www.stevenknudson.com/184315_7362a.html